Intense Search Fails To Locate Body Of Missing Michigan Woman

(WWJ/AP) Searchers from around Michigan are pledging to return to the Battle Creek area to look for the body of a woman who disappeared in late June.

Two people have been charged in the apparent death of 27-year-old Amber Griffin, including her boyfriend, 25-year-old Derek Horton.


About 30 volunteers worked together Sunday, some from as far away as Alpena, to try to find Griffin's body in Calhoun County. 

The search included nationally certified volunteers from the Michigan Independent Search and Rescue Team, Alpena County Search and Rescue, as well as K-9 teams.

Cherie Parenteau assisted with her dog, Loki.

"There's a lot that goes into this. It's not just, 'Hey somebody's missing, can you go look for them.' ... The hardest part is not having answers for the family or sometimes not the answers they want," Parenteau told WWMT

Griffin was last seen with Horton at a party early in the morning of June 23. 

Horton reported her missing the next day after he claimed he saw her leave their home on Oneita Street at around midnight. However, police say evidence poked holes in the boyfriend's story. 

"Eventually detectives located a crime scene in the city of Battle Creek. We found evidence that look like it was a violent assault that took place. And we believe assault took place with Griffin and Horton,"  Battle Creek Detective Sgt. Joel Case told reporters t

WOOD-TV reported Horton can allegedly be seen on surveillance video buying a shovel at a Battle Creek hardware store, and that police believe Horton killed and buried Griffin. 

They just don't know where, and authorities say Horton — who remains jailed — won't offer any information. 

Horton remains held without hond on an open murder charge. Also in custody is 27-year-old Julice Haggerty, who is charged with tampering with evidence and lying to a peace officer in a violent crime investigation.
